Output 42e31529433dee3efacfd553375b63d0ac8602bb6cd3b400430241e3e9dc2ac1:1

value
176000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d6068df89e13313cc4c94d2ec7ad1dfc85eff8 OP_EQUAL
address
3JuVMNGcdJfAd9rJRfsWZT2rcHZvh63GfA
transaction
42e31529433dee3efacfd553375b63d0ac8602bb6cd3b400430241e3e9dc2ac1
confirmations
257965
spent
true